Renzo Gracie Head Professor Zed Chierighini
Zed is a Black belt under Renzo Gracie that has been training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u for over 17 years. Zed is originally from Florianopolis; city on southern tip of Brazil. As a 5 time Pan American medalist, 2004 NAGA Champion and a 8 time South Brazil champion Zed is more then qualified to appoint as IKAIKA's head instructor.
   
Louis Levy
Senior Instructor Louis Levy
Louis is a former Division 1 athlete that specializes in "No Gi " . He is well versed in nutritional health, strength training and conditioning. A 2006 NAGA World Champion that has had the experience of training in Asia and the top academies in America.

Meaning of Ikaika

IKAIKA in Hawaiian has many different meanings.Warrior, Vigor, Energy, Strength, Perseverance, Powerful and Mighty. These different meanings are all associated with Brazilian Jui Jitsu and make up the foundation of our program.
